OCCUPY TILL I COME (LUKE 19:12-28; GAL. 6:7-9) Video link: • OCCUPY TILL I COME (PART 1) Introduction Luke 19:12-13 (NKJV): “12HE SAID THEREFORE, A CERTAIN NOBLEMAN WENT INTO A FAR COUNTRY TO RECEIVE FOR HIMSELF A KINGDOM, AND TO RETURN. 13AND HE CALLED HIS TEN SERVANTS, AND DELIVERED THEM TEN POUNDS, AND SAID UNTO THEM, OCCUPY TILL I COME”. Gal. 6:7 (NIV): "DO NOT BE DECEIVED: GOD CANNOT BE MOCKED. A MAN REAPS WHAT HE SOWS.” Body The business mindset we see today originates from THE ALMIGHTY GOD who desires profit in all HE does and gives to us. Brethren, we'll give account of everything we do. But before then, we must learn to be prudent with the gifts/talents our LORD JESUS CHRIST has given us. The clause “Occupy till I come” in Luke 19:13 as captured in seven different Bible translations is provided below: • KJV: ‘Occupy till I come’ • NKJV: ‘Do business till I come’ • CEV: ‘Use this money to earn more money until I get back’ • NIV: ‘Put this money to work’ • NLT: ‘Invest this for me while I am gone’ • ASV: ‘Trade ye herewith till I come’ Are you a leader or member of a department in the Church? Where are the profits from your assignment? Even in our secular work, the LORD wants us to bear fruits, i.e., have gains. From our first main text, we'll also see that it's not enough to bear fruits, but we must bear them optimally. From the first main text, the MASTER only gave additional money to the servant who has ten pounds (vs. 24). Luke 19:24 (NLT): ‘THEN, TURNING TO THE OTHERS STANDING NEARBY, THE KING ORDERED, ‘TAKE THE MONEY FROM THIS SERVANT, AND GIVE IT TO THE ONE WHO HAS TEN POUNDS.’ Hence, we must always remember that we’ll reap whatsoever we sow and never to get tired of doing what is good. Gal. 6:8-9 (NIV) says “8WHOEVER SOWS TO PLEASE THEIR FLESH, FROM THE FLESH WILL REAP DESTRUCTION; WHOEVER SOWS TO PLEASE THE SPIRIT, FROM THE SPIRIT WILL REAP ETERNAL LIFE. 9LET US NOT BECOME WEARY IN DOING GOOD, FOR AT THE PROPER TIME WE WILL REAP A HARVEST IF WE DO NOT GIVE UP.” The verse 9 in NLT (Chapter 6) is given as “SO LET’S NOT GET TIRED OF DOING WHAT IS GOOD. AT JUST THE RIGHT TIME WE WILL REAP A HARVEST OF BLESSING IF WE DON’T GIVE UP.” Conclusion Like the nobleman in the main text, our LORD JESUS CHRIST is coming back.
